摘要

Chiral Schiff base ruthenium(II) carbonyl complexes of the type [Ru(CO)(L')(B)] (L'= tetradentate Schiff bases; B=PPh3 , pyridine (py), piperidine (pip) or morpholine (morph)) has been synthesised by the reactions of [RuHCl(CO)(PPh3)(2) (B)] (B=PPh3 or py or pip or morph) with appropriate Schiff bases having the donor groups (O,N) viz., bis[3(1'-naphthyl)salicylidenecyclohexanediimine] (L1) or bis[3(1'-naphthyl)salicylidenepropylenediimine] (L2) or bis[3(1'-naphthyl)salicylidenediphenyldiimine] (L3) in 11 molar ratio. Complexes have been characterized by elemental analyses and spectral (IR, electronic, H-1- and P-31-NMR) data. An octahedral structure has been tentatively proposed for all the new complexes. The catalytic and antibacterial activities have also been carried out for these new complexes.
